Tips And Comments:
- Playing Technique: Played between pickups with differents dynamics throughout the song (try listening to the band and choosing the right dynamics). Used a pick. All knobs at full
- Gear Sound: For the whole song i used a cab emulator with high and low end activated, added treble, bass, middle at 5 or a little more. High gain and a layer of overdrive (just a little) behind.
For the intro i added an octaver with the high octave a little lower, that repeats on the intro riff and a little fill in between. For the solo i added delay and overdrive with octaver too.
Honestly i'm not very proud of the tone, i know i don't have the right equipment but i did what i can
- About The Song: Some parts are hard but i think the trickiest might be the part after the solo, specially for the string skipping. Try practicing that slowly. Transcribed from studio version and positions corrected with live videos (it was hard to see most of the line, so positions might change)

There are a total of 108 time signature changes in dance of eternity. Holy shit.
@@shayanmoosavi9139 Dance of Eternity? Harder Guitar, Bass, Keyboard than any Tool song? Definitely a hard YES. Harder drums? I'll just straight up say it - NO.
Just because a song has 108 time changes doesn't mean it's hard. You can feel the whole song. And it's not like Portnoy is leading the rhythm section. All he does is mimicking/following the guitar and keyboard on the drums which again makes it more easier.
Something like the 3 over 4 polyrhythm from Eulogy or the 6/8 over 5/8 polymeter from Lateralus that Danny Carey does is harder cause Danny becomes (and is) the lead instrumentalist of the band and guitars and bass are following Danny instead
Also I wouldn't quite put Portnoy in the "legendary" status. That dude is more showmanship than drumming. Like 90% of the fills he uses in every song is just some linear RLRLKK or some variation of that. It sounds cool to non drummers but to drummers like us, it really gets repetitive and boring
